SUMMARY:Figure & Form: Sculptural Ceramics
DESCRIPTION:Figure & Form: Sculptural Ceramics with Alix Messimer\nSession: July 1 – August 5 (6 Wednesdays)\nWednesdays | 4:30 – 7:30 PMFee: $205 CAE Members / $235 Non-Members\nIncludes: Use of studio tools, glazes & firingClay: Sold separately — $25 per 25 lb bag (available at the front desk) – Soldate 60\nAges/Level: Adults 16+ | All Skill LevelsMin/Max: 3 / 10\nClass Overview\nExplore the expressive world of sculptural ceramics in this six-week class focused on figure and form. Whether you’re new to sculpture or looking to expand your ceramic practice, this course offers a supportive space to experiment, build, and bring your ideas to life in three dimensions.\nStudents will be guided through the process of designing and constructing figurative or abstract sculptural forms, with an emphasis on structure, proportion, and personal expression. Along the way, you’ll learn how to work with clay at different stages, safely build and hollow forms, and explore a range of finishing techniques—including both traditional glazing and alternative surface treatments.\nThrough demos, guided instruction, and open studio time, students will develop both technical skills and their own creative voice.\nAll studio tools are provided. Please bring a sketchbook or project journal, apron, and hand towels. Clay is purchased separately.\nWeekly Breakdown\nWeek 1: Introductions, overview of sculptural ceramics, slide presentation, begin concept development and buildingWeek 2: Demos and figure/form constructionWeek 3: Continued figure/form constructionWeek 4: Final construction and hollowing (forms should be completed by the end of class)Week 5: Demos on finishing techniques—cold finishes and alternative surface treatmentsWeek 6: Finalizing projects, critique, cleanup, and celebration\nInstagram: @a.messi.sculpture\nwww.amessisculpture.com\n
